Transaction 40231ee70fe1ed568d26c49a1f764155dfc4fc2e634f2731137fd777e16d4f1e
1 Input
2 Outputs
- 40231ee70fe1ed568d26c49a1f764155dfc4fc2e634f2731137fd777e16d4f1e:0
- 40231ee70fe1ed568d26c49a1f764155dfc4fc2e634f2731137fd777e16d4f1e:1
value 32229610
address 3A3S3vZiDDzmEGa49K4h7BAXsCGdyvjykg
value 49127589
address 1JmaZGZ7jEVU4di6eFFNVhGp2aSXCiPtdJ